Study Summary

The primary objective is to collect OCT scans on a modified P200TxE and P200TE.

Primary Outcome

The primary endpoint will be the collection of OCT scans on the P200TE and P200TxE devices. The scans will be used by R\&D for development of a de-noising algorithm as well as other possible developments.

Interventions

  • DEVICE Imaging Session
